I suspect that your drive may be "locked" in some way for DRM reasons.

Here is a thread where a WD drive was unlocked, but a Hitachi issue remained unresolved:
http://www.alexsoft.org/viewtopic.php?f=95&t=812

One thing you might like to try is to power up the drive in your DTV box, and then hotswap the SATA data cable with a cable connected to a PC motherboard. Hopefully HDAT2 should then be able to see the drive. You probably won't be able to circumvent the lock (if it exists), but hopefully you may be able to see something in the drive's feature set that sets it apart from normal models.
